- The distance between Wairoa, Frasertown, New Zealand and New Bedford, Ma, Usa is approximately 14,380 km or 8,936 mi.
- To reach Wairoa, Frasertown in this distance one would set out from New Bedford, Ma bearing 249.1° or WSW and follow the great circles arc to approach Wairoa, Frasertown bearing 243.3° or WSW .
- Wairoa, Frasertown has a marine west coast climate (Cfb) whereas New Bedford, Ma has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a).
- Wairoa, Frasertown is in or near the cool temperate steppe biome whereas New Bedford, Ma is in or near the cool temperate wet forest biome.
- The mean annual temperature is 3.1 °C (5.6°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 13.7 °C (24.7°F) less in Wairoa, Frasertown. The continentality subtype is barely hyperoceanic as opposed to subcont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 215.3 mm (8.5 in) more which is equivalent to 215.3 l/m² (5.28 US gal/ft²) or 2,153,000 l/ha (230,170 US gal/ac) more. About 1 1/6 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 2.3° higher in Wairoa, Frasertown than in New Bedford, Ma.
